1.0 Preface and Introduction To fully realize the benefits of health IT, the Office of the National Coordinator for Health Information

Technology (ONC), as part of the Standards and Interoperability (S&I) Framework is developing Use

Cases and associated functional requirements that define the requirements for health care data

exchange. The functional requirements document is used to specify requirements from a broad range of

stakeholders interested in a specific information exchange. Examples of stakeholders include but are

not limited to healthcare providers, EHR system vendors, public health organizations, and federal

agencies.

The functional requirements described in this document pertain to public health reporting data

exchange and help define:

• The operational context for the data exchange

• The stakeholders with an interest in specific user stories

• The information flows that must be supported by the data exchange

• The types of data and their required specifications for data exchange

The document provides the foundation for identifying and specifying the standards required to support

the data exchange, and facilitate development and/or identification of reference implementations and

tools needed to ensure consistent adoption and applicability of the data exchange standards across

user stories. This document is not intended to replace existing functional requirements or

implementation guides currently in use across the various public health reporting functions referenced

in this document.

2.0 Initiative Overview The Public Health Reporting Initiative (PHRI) is a community-led S&I Framework initiative focused on

harmonizing information exchange standards and creating implementation specifications for public

health 1 reporting from healthcare providers to public health agencies. Our goal is to create a

harmonized specification that can be used to help reduce costs and reporting burden of healthcare

providers to public health agencies. The new specification can be used to promote health information

technology (HIT) adoption and facilitate electronic public health reporting from EHR systems for a

variety of reporting scenarios.

The PHRI consolidated use case was derived using a sample of existing public health reporting scenarios

submitted by Public Health Reporting Initiative members. Some of the user stories submitted for this

initiative reflect current workflows and information flows, but others represent a proposed future state.

For this use case, “public health reporting” refers to provider-initiated information exchange between

healthcare providers such as private physician practices and hospitals to a public health agency. In

particular, this use case will address electronic transmission of EHR-generated or assisted healthcare

provider reports, and receipt or retrieval by the public health agency. Report content for this use case is

based upon patient-level EHR data that is extracted and/or reused to create compliant reports that

meet reporting criteria of the representative public health report types (domains) supported in the use

case.

1 The term “public health,” as used in this document, refers to public health and patient safety programs.

In the short-term, the Initiative seeks to define criteria and requirements for improved data exchange

standards, specifications and validation rules for sending EHR-generated or assisted reports from a

healthcare provider to a public health agency. The long-term goals of the initiative include:

• Reduce variability in data exchange standards supported by different public health agency

systems covering the same or different jurisdictions

• Increase interoperability and data exchange from healthcare providers to public health agencies

• Reduce the burden on senders to create and manage different data exchanges based upon the

use of the same or similar source clinical or administrative data

• Reduce the burden on public health agencies to receive, extract, translate, load, and analyze

information contained in healthcare provider reports.

This document will build upon the existing use case document to define the functional and non-

functional requirements. In addition, this document references a data model and data element

mapping as outputs generated by harmonization of the user stories submitted under this initiative.

2.1 Initiative Challenge Statement Much public health reporting currently relies on paper forms that are mailed, emailed or faxed; thus

necessitating manual data collection and transmission by providers, and/or manual data entry and

coding by the public health agency prior to initiating analysis or follow-up. There is relatively little

nationwide standardization of public health electronic information exchange, although standardization

does seem to be increasing. . Even when reporting is performed electronically, there are multiple

regulatory or statutory requirements and implementation specifications that cover different reporting

activities. Varied reporting requirements and methods impose burdens on both healthcare providers

and public health agencies to support multiple formats and manage competing requirements defined by

mandated or voluntary reporting programs. Additionally, multiple data exchange standards used for

public health reporting (e.g., HL7 Versions 2.x and 3 messages and HL7 Clinical Document Architecture

(CDA)) introduce additional variability across reporting programs because of differences in data

standards adoption and implementation timelines, data elements, terminology and metadata. The need

to accommodate and manage these variations and extensibility of existing data exchanges increases the

costs and barriers for reporting, data sharing and data reuse for both the senders and receivers of public

health reports.

The PHRI aims to reduce the costs associated with the variability of building and maintaining disparate

specifications. In addition, as a complement to this reduction in costs, this initiative aims to simplify

data exchange and improve interoperability across reporting scenarios for both the senders and

receivers of public health reports. The anticipated healthcare benefit of a successful initiative is a more

standardized and efficient set of infrastructure requirements (standards, terminology, specifications and

tools) applicable to multiple types of provider-initiated public health reports which are typically

mandated by law or regulation. The anticipated public health benefit is more timely, reliable, secure,

standardized and efficient public health reporting which can be received and managed by a more

uniform infrastructure. Automated reporting to public health agencies will help streamline both

manual, paper-based operations and variable electronic requirements and should result in improved

efficiency. By receiving faster and more harmonized reports, public health agencies should be able to

improve their public health surveillance and risk/harm mitigation activities, which should result in

reductions in preventable disease, disability and death.

3.0 Use Case Scope The PHRI Use Case focuses on a provider-initiated report – a report sent from a provider (using an EHR

system) to a public health agency system containing information about a particular public health event.

The report (at a minimum) will contain specific information about what occurred and the relevant

patient-level information. The report will include data elements automatically populated with

information from the patient’s record in the EHR; it may also include additional information manually

entered by healthcare personnel using the EHR interface. The basic reporting transactions covered by

this use case are:

• Send report (EHR System)

• Receive report (Public Health Agency System)

• Send acknowledgement of report receipt (Public Health Agency System)

• Receive acknowledgement of report receipt (EHR system)

The reporting transactions are described by two potential information flows between an EHR system

and a public health agency. The primary report flow (“basic flow”) is the transmission of a report

directly from the provider’s EHR system to the public health agency system. The alternate report flow is

the transmission of the report from the EHR system through an intermediary system, such as a Health

Information Exchange or Incident Reporting System, to a public health agency.

The Initiative recognizes that cases and reportable events may be identified through a variety of means,

including, but not limited to, provider recognition and/or automated EHR detection. The mechanism for

identifying such reportable events is out of scope for the Public Health Reporting Initiative – the scope

of the Initiative is identifying and defining required and optional data elements for an EHR system to

include in a provider-initiated report and sending it to a public health agency system.

Note that it is not the intent of this initiative to circumvent existing public health reporting infrastructure

or supercede existing widely-used implementation guides (such as those cited in Stages 1 or 2 of the

EHR Incentive Program - “Meaningful Use”). Those public health programs with existing information

exchange specifications that satisfy their requirements (e.g. immunization registry reporting; healthcare

acquired infection reporting) may continue to use existing implementation guides to support their

needs. At the same time, the Public Health Reporting Initiative has welcomed participation from

participants in such existing information exchange and recognizes that both new and established forms

of exchange may benefit from our efforts to develop harmonized reporting content and format.

3.1 Background On February 17, 2009, the President signed the American Recovery and Reinvestment Act of 2009

(ARRA). This statute includes the Health Information Technology for Economic and Clinical Health Act of

2009 (the HITECH Act) that set forth a plan for advancing the Meaningful Use (MU) of health information

technology (HIT) to improve quality of care and establish a foundation for healthcare reform. Two

Federal Advisory Committees, Health IT Policy and Health IT Standards have been established under this

legislation. In 2010 these Committees identified three types of public health reporting that were

adopted for MU Stage 1 of the HITECH-funded Centers for Medicare and Medicaid Services (CMS)

Incentive Program:

• Capability to submit electronic syndromic surveillance data to public health agencies and actual

transmission according to applicable law and practice.

• Capability to submit electronic data to immunization registries of Immunization Information

Systems and actual submission in accordance with applicable law and practice.

• Capability to submit electronic data on reportable (as required by state or local law) lab results

to public health agencies and actual submission in accordance with applicable law and practice.

Both Committees recognize that these three types of public health reporting represent just a few of the

many types of ongoing information exchange between healthcare providers and public health agencies,

and that creating a unique implementation specification for each would impose long-term burdens on

healthcare providers and agencies alike. Both have suggested that simpler approaches to managing

public health reporting be considered for future stages of Meaningful Use 2 .

ONC manages the S&I Framework to leverage existing and new HIT standards and tools, and to

harmonize and implement standards specifications (implementation specifications) in order to promote

electronic health information exchange interoperability nationwide. In 2011, several S&I Framework

Initiatives were established to provide clarification in HIT standards selected for MU and guide

standards-based products and certification including the Laboratory Results Interface (LRI) Workgroup

and its Public Health Laboratory Reporting Workgroup. The Public Health Laboratory Reporting

Workgroup recognized that additional information is needed for prompt assessment and response to

reportable diseases beyond that contained in the MU Stage 1 implementation specification for

laboratory result reporting. Similar types of information are needed for other kinds of public health

reports. During the ONC S&I Framework face-to-face meeting in Washington DC, June 14-15, 2011 the

LRI Public Health Workgroup proposed establishing the Public Health Reporting Initiative within the ONC

S&I Framework to better understand public health reporting needs and define standards-based

interoperability specifications.

3.2 In Scope The following activities are in scope for the PHRI Functional Requirements analysis:

• Identifying and harmonizing the core reporting data elements required by public health agencies

shared by various types of reportable events

• Identifying and harmonizing (to extent practical) additional data elements required by public

health agencies for specific types of reportable events (e.g., newborn hearing screening or

healthcare associated infections)

• Defining a standard exchange format including structure and content (i.e., vocabulary)

• Defining the requirements for limited bi-directional data exchange between EHR systems and

public health agency systems – sending the report, receiving the report, and transmitting an

acknowledgement of receipt

• Identifying the content requirements to send reports from certified EHR systems (in a variety of

clinical settings where EHR data is used for reporting purposes – for example, inpatient,

outpatient, emergency room, urgent care, etc.) to public health agencies (Note: the initiative

recognizes that other report information (e.g., administrative, laboratory, pharmacy) may be

imported from separate systems into the EHR in order to complete a public health report;

however, the functional requirements for these systems, including the EHR interface

requirements, are not in scope for this use case)

3.3 Out of Scope The following activities are out of scope for the PHRI Functional Requirements analysis:

• Defining specifications and guidelines on reportable event criteria (e.g., defining reportable

conditions) – by law these specifications typically rest with states. This Initiative will enable

healthcare providers to submit a report based on jurisdictionally-defined laws and regulation,

but will not be responsible for actually creating those reporting criteria

• Describing the precise processes for healthcare providers to add information into an EHR

manually or from an auxiliary (e.g., administrative, laboratory, pharmacy, etc.) system, or how

EHRs or providers recognize public health report “triggers”. It is expected that these details

would be defined by an implementation or demonstration project for a specific user story /

public health reporting scenario;

• Describing the process for public health agencies to perform follow-up activities, including case

monitoring

• Defining specifications and guidelines for reporting by other communications methods such as

telephone, web-based data entry, mailed, or faxed reports)

• Describing any additional or extensive bi-directional communication between a public health

agency and a healthcare provider beyond the limited exchange supported by this use case (i.e.,

the sending of a public health report and the acknowledgement of receipt of that report)

• Identifying transport protocols

• Identifying security requirements, methodologies, procedures, and/or protocols

• Identifying information and data stewardship practices and policies

This Initiative acknowledges that all functions supported by current reporting programs are not

addressed in this document; the Initiative focuses on a common functional starting point – the presence

of key information in an EHR system that is needed to generate a public health report. The Initiative has

identified other use cases that may have similar actors and information requirements, but which are in

some ways distinct and out of scope for this initiative. These out-of-scope use cases include, but are not

limited to, the following:

• Patient referral to a public health agency (e.g., tobacco quit-line) for services. In this scenario,

the initial public health report may not reflect all the necessary information for the referral or

transition of care or all requirements for the bidirectional exchange that would typically follow a

referral

• A request for information initiated by a clinical provider about a patient (or set of patients) and

sent to a public health system (e.g., a request for a complete immunization history from a public

health Immunization Information System.. Again, the content and flow of information may have

requirements that go beyond those of simple provider-initiated public health reports.

• Other Standards and Interoperability Initiatives (e.g. Transitions of Care and Query Health) are

alternate use cases that may (now or in the future) also be used to support public health

surveillance in addition to or as a replacement for Public Health Reporting, and may inform or

be informed by the PHRI content and format specifications.

However, it is likely that the harmonized data elements and specifications produced by this initiative

will also expedite the implementation of these alternate use cases. For example, data elements such as

the contact information for the subject of the report may support follow-up activities of public health

programs. Thus we welcome the participation of persons interested in these use cases in defining the

products of this Initiative. It is also possible that future phases of this initiative may address some

aspects of these other use cases, although they remain are out of scope for the current phase.

3.5 Actors and Roles The table below describes the roles of the actors in the public health reporting workflow. More detail

about each action in the workflow is provided in later sections.

Actor Role

Healthcare Provider • Deliver care to patient

• Enters information into EHR

• If applicable – suspect reportable event to begin

report generation process

• If applicable – send any immediately-required

public health reports

• If applicable – add information, sign, and/or

verify public health report prior to sending

EHR System (healthcare provider system) • Collect, receive, and/or store patient-level data

• Support additional data entry (e.g. populate

data on an electronic form and allow healthcare

provider to add information)

• Generate public health report and make it

available for validation

• Validate public health report based on

implementation-specific business rules when

automation of validation is possible/allowable.

• Send report to public health agency either

directly or through an intermediary

• Receive acknowledgement either directly or

through an intermediary

Public Health Agency System • Receive report from EHR system or intermediary

• Generate acknowledgement from public health

agency

• Send acknowledgement to EHR system either

directly or through an intermediary

4.0 Public Health Reporting Workflow The following diagrams and tables describe the public health reporting workflow, indicating the roles of

specific actors and whether or not an action is in scope, out of scope, or specific to a particular

implementation. The use case assumes that all information needed to complete a valid public health

report is made available to the EHR system to generate and send a report. The initiative recognizes that

the functions of generating, sending, receiving, and acknowledging a public health report are dependent

upon automated and/or manual process to incorporate relevant clinical, laboratory, and/or

administrative data within the EHR system. The functional requirements for these processes are not

within the scope of the initiative, however, the reporting workflow assumes that these functions will

become available and operational.

The first diagram, “Public Health Reporting Workflow,” illustrates the public health reporting workflow,

calling out actions that are implementation-specific, in scope, or out of scope. It includes paths to

accomodate the ‘basic flow’ – where a report is sent directly from an EHR system to a public health

agency system – and the ‘alternate flow’ – where the report is sent from and EHR system through an

intermediary system to the public health agency. It illustrates the transactions and decisions that are

required to create and send a provider-initiated report.

It is important to note that the following diagrams represent a generic flow of information and

operations based on a provider initiated report to a public health information system, with a simple

acknowledgement of receipt of the specific report. This is a result of considering a broad range of user

stories from across the spectrum of public health responsibilities. This representation of the information

flow does not represent critical components to several public health programs which rely on the

creation of case and patient records based on a care transition, those that are sourced from multiple

data sources, and / or those that require reconciliation / de-duplication of records. However, these

additional operations can and do impact the content requirements, format standards and information

Additional details about the actions in the public health reporting workflow are presented in the

following table. Actions are not numbered as they are not necessarily sequential steps. Many of the

actions depicted in the workflow have implementation-specific functional requirements that are out of

the scope of the Public Health Reporting Initiative, but should be considered for an implementation.

Action Additional Information

Healthcare Provider - Refers to the healthcare provider and/or associated staff (e.g., administrative

personnel, clinician, physician, nurses, etc.)

Note that defining the actions of the healthcare provider are out of scope for the Initiative.

Deliver care, order tests, treat

patient, etc…

Describes the healthcare provider action at time of patient

encounter. Specific action depends on provider workflow.

Enter information into patient’s

Electronic Health Record

Information about the patient / patient encounter is entered

into the specific record for that patient in the EHR system.

Suspect reportable event The healthcare provider may suspect a reportable event based

on the patient encounter – this action is ‘optional’ and should

occur concurrently with the EHR system detection of a possible

reportable event.

Immediately sends report to public

health agency as jurisdictionally

mandated.

If the EHR system (or provider, depending on specific triggers

and/or workflows) determines that public health must be

immediately notified of the reportable event (based on

jurisdictional regulations), the healthcare provider is

responsible for transmitting the report. Note that depending

on workflow and regulations, this report may be a phone call

and/or may be an instruction to the EHR system to immediately

send the public health report. Depending on the mechanism of

transmission, the mechanism of receipt by the public health

agency may vary – for example, a health official could accept a

phone call report while a system would accept an electronic

report.

Add information, sign, and/or verify

public health report

If manual action by the healthcare provider is required, the

healthcare provider completes the required manual actions,

based on provider workflows and jurisdictional regulations, to

send the public health report.

EHR System – Refers to a healthcare provider’s Electronic Health Record System that manages electronic

health records for patients

Compiles / stores patient information

(e.g., patient encounter information,

test results, transmission log)

Information may be manually entered into the EHR system or

electronically provided from supporting systems. For example,

a healthcare provider may enter patient notes into a patient’s

electronic health record. However, laboratory test results for a

patient may be transmitted to that patient’s electronic health

record from a supporting system. Defining the requirements

associated with this action are out of scope for the Initiative,

but should be considered when identifying data elements for

public health reporting.

Detect possible reportable event Based on defined reporting criteria (dependent on jurisdictional

regulations), the EHR system (or, if applicable, the event

detection rules engine) identifies a possible reportable event

associated with a patient. Note that defining the specific

reporting criteria and business rules to identify reportable

events is out of scope of the Initiative.

Generate / assemble public health

report

A public health report is generated and populated based on

specific requirements (e.g., data elements, formats, etc.). The

actual mechanism to generate and assemble the information

(e.g., user interface) is out of scope of the Initiative, but

identifying the data elements that should be included in the

public health report is in scope.

Decision: Immediate report required? The EHR system or provider (depending on specific

implementation) determines if an immediate report to public

health is required, based on specific jurisdictional requirements.

If applicable, the EHR system notifies the healthcare provider

that an immediate report is required. Note that depending on

the implementation, an immediate report may be sent via

phone call or other method or from the EHR system at the

discretion of the healthcare provider. These actions are

accounted for in the public health reporting workflow, but out

of scope for the Initiative.

Decision: Manual action required? The EHR system, based on provider-specific workflows,

determines if manual action to continue the public health

reporting process is required. Defining in detail these actions

and business rules are out of scope for the Initiative.

Generate / populate report for

healthcare provider

If a manual action by the healthcare provider is required to

continue the public health reporting process, the EHR system

generates/populates a report for the healthcare provider. Note

that depending on the implementation, this report may be

displayed through a user interface designed for the provider

(e.g., task list, worksheet, form, etc.). This report is not

necessarily in the same structure as the public health report,

but should be built using the same information. Defining the

mechanism to display this user interface is out of scope for the

Initiative.

Verify / validate public health report The EHR system verifies / validates the public health report by

evaluating its compliance with the specific report requirements

and other implementation-specific business rules. Defining

these business rules is out of scope.

Decision: Verified/validated public

health report?

The EHR system determines if the public health report satisfies

the requirements or requires revisions. Note that if the report

fails the verification / validation step, it is returned to the

healthcare provider for revisions based on a workflow designed

by the provider. Defining the specific actions and business rules

associated with this step are out of scope.

Send public health report If the public health report passes the verification / validation

step, the EHR system electronically sends the public health

report containing the appropriate information in the

appropriate format. The public health report may be sent

either directly to the public health agency or through an

intermediary system, such as an HIE. Defining the data element

and information exchange requirements associated with

sending the report are in scope for the Initiative.

Receive acknowledgement The EHR system receives an acknowledgement that the public

health agency received the public health report. This

acknowledgement may be received directly from the public

health agency system or through an intermediary system, such

as an HIE. The acknowledgement is stored in the EHR system,

based on implementation-specific requirements. The actual

mechanism of receiving and/or storing the acknowledgement is

out of scope.

Public Health Agency System – Refers to a system at a public health agency designed to collect

information on a reportable event.

Receive public health report The public health agency system receives the public health

report. Note that this report may come from the EHR system

directly or through an intermediary system. Additionally, the

public health agency system may receive a report directly from

a healthcare provider (via phone or other mechanism) if

jurisdictional regulations require an immediate report. Finally,

the public health agency system, as part of a separate

workflow, may receive a report from a supporting system, such

as a laboratory system, where jurisdictionally mandated.

Defining the data and structure of the public health report is in

scope for the Initiative.

Send initial acknowledgement Once the public health agency has received a report, an

acknowledgement of receipt is sent to the sending system

(either HIE or EHR system). Note that this acknowledgement is

sent before any evaluation of the public health report is

performed by the public health agency. The acknowledgement

reflects only the fact that the public health agency received a

public health report from a sending system. The actual

mechanism of creating such an acknowledgement is out of

scope for the Initiatve.

Validate / verify report The Public Health Agency will perform implementation-specific

procedures to verify / validate the report received from the EHR

system. Note that defining these procedures is out of scope for

the Initiative.

Decision: Valid report? Based on public health agency business processes and

requirements, the public health agency system evaluates the

validity of the public health report. The outcome of this

decision has no impact on the sending of an initial

acknowledgement of receipt to the sending system, but may

lead to additional actions depending on the implementation.

Note that this action is out of scope for the Public Health

Reporting Initiative.

De-duplicate and merge records Depending on public health agency business processes, any

5.2 System Requirements System requirements provided in the table below refer to the base (direct transmission) and alternate

(transmission through intermediary system) flow requirements and reflect functions needed to support

various scenarios described in the use case. Note that reporting scenarios may or may not include fully

automated functions – for example, integration with a Clinical Decision Support system for managing

reporting criteria and/or triggers. However, the table includes information for both automated and

manual functions that are needed to support the use case.

System System Requirement

Electronic Health Record System Interface with appropriate clinical, administrative,

laboratory, pharmacy or other systems to receive and

store relevant patient information needed to

generate compliant public health reports

Electronic Health Record System Interface with a clinical decision support system to

receive, store and process public health reporting

criteria and/or triggers

Electronic Health Record System Provide a user interface to support manual entry or

updates to public health reporting criteria or triggers

by healthcare providers or other staff.

Electronic Health Record System Extract data (if outside the EHR system) and render

information needed to create a public health report

based on the appropriate jurisdictional reporting

criteria

Electronic Health Record System Render a public health report for subsequent

validation, completion, verification and certification

Healthcare provider interface Renders a report form for completion, verification,

and certification when necessary

EHR / Healthcare provider interface Generates Public Health Report

EHR reporting module Sends public health report to public health agency

receiving system; archives copy of report and data

exchange transmission; receive and archive Public

Health Agency system acknowedgements

Public health agency system Receives EHR public health report; generate and send

report receipt acknowledgements Table 5: Public Health Reporting General System Requirements

5.3 Triggers A public health event (such as a new diagnosis of tuberculosis) requiring a public health report is

typically defined by criteria established by local, state or federal statutes, regulations or guidelines.

These criteria may be unique to a specific public health agency or surveillance program, and are

essentially defined by the business requirements of public health surveillance and intervention. Some

reportable events may not even involve a diagnosis, for example, childhood blood lead tests or newborn

hearing examinations may be reportable whether or not they are abnormal. Report creation is

dependent upon healthcare provider discovery or identification of a possible public health event of

interest and comparison of that potential event with criteria. Today in most cases, this a manual

process. Event discovery or detection is a result of data from direct patient care encounters or

assessments of other health information, such as results from laboratory test or diagnostic procedures.

However, depending upon the reporting criteria, IT automation can be applied to the event detection or

discovery process such that direct healthcare provider interaction or intervention is reduced or not

required to initiate the reporting process. For example, a single laboratory test result, a single diagnosis

code, or a combination of demographic and diagnostic elements may algorithmically trigger recognition

of a reportable event by an EHR or by a supporting application.

In the context of this use case, the term “trigger” is used to convey automation of one or more event

discovery or detection parameters based upon jurisdictionally defined reporting criteria. Automated

detection and initiation of the reporting process can be programmatically defined in a computer system

(EHR) or supporting application (such as an EHR services platform, or ESP). The initiation of the

reporting process can be triggered by the presence of information contained in the EHR that meets the

jurisdictionally defined reporting criteria that is used to determine if a report should be sent to a public

health agency. Automated triggers are created or programmed using the reporting criteria and can be

based upon several factors that include but are not limited to:

• Mandated reporting criteria specified by jurisdictional (e.g., federal, state, local or territorial)

legislation, statute or regulation.

• Surveillance criteria for voluntary reporting specified by an organization (e.g., public health

agency, healthcare provider, quality improvement organization, registry, etc.)

• Criteria may include observations or assessments made by healthcare providers or other staff,

whether or not they are documented within the EHR. For example, the suspicion of certain

diseases alone may constitute a reportable condition, whether or not it is written as a diagnosis

in the EHR.

• The presence of specific data or documentation, or a combination of items, within an EHR that

meets the reporting criteria.

As EHR public health reporting functions are designed and piloted, implementers will have to consider

these factors, as well as the clinical workflow, clinical / administrative policies, and report validation /

certification processes. Some implementations may depend upon manual processes to initiate and

execute public health reporting, while others may be partially or fully automated based on the functions

6.0 Non-Functional Requirements Non-functional Requirements are those requirements that reflect required operational needs, rather

than functional information flow operations. Non-functional requirements are generally

implementation-specific and may vary based on healthcare provider workflow, report type, etc.

These requirements include, but are not limited to, the following:

Type Description

Quality Requirements for quality, reliability, performance,

usability, supportability, and/or implementation.

Constraints Requirements related to security, accessibility,

jurisdictional reporting requirements and

operations, operations, interfaces, and other legal

constraints.

Workflow Requirements related to implementation-specific

workflows (e.g., how a healthcare provider adds

information to or signs a public health report

generated by the EHR system)

Timeliness Requirements related to the timeliness of

reporting

Transmission Mode Requirements related to the batching of reports

vs. the submission of a single report

Consent policies Most types of public health reports are mandated

without patient consent (e.g., the report of a

communicable disease). Others may depend on

consent, often depending on jurisdictional laws

(for example, some immunization registries or

developmental disability registries only collect

information with consent). Especially when

intermediary systems are involved, consent

policies need to correspond to public health legal

requirements. For example, an HIE that only

exchanges information by consent would not be

suitable for most public health reporting. Table 6: Types of Non-Functional Requirements

Non-functional requirements may vary based upon the specific public health agency or program’s

policies. For example, timeframe for reporting, (e.g., within 24 hours of event discovery), may have

operational implications for human and system actors supporting the specific reporting scenarios

expected that pilot implementations will provide a greater level of detail concerning the non functional

requirements relevant to their EHR systems, which includes internal IT infrastructure considerations and

7.0 Dependencies and Future Considerations

7.1 Dependencies As a secondary user of clinical information, public health programs rely on the security, accessibility,

reliability, consistency, and quality of information from providers and other information sources that are

not under direct management or regulation of public health agencies. As such, there are several

business processes, policy and technical dependencies that must be understood by report senders and

receivers to both enable specific public health reporting exchanges, and to help promote the long term

sustainability of nationwide public health information exchanges.

These dependencies include, but are not limited to, the following:

Type Description

Certification As the functional and data requirements for

certified electronic health record systems and

modules evolve, there may be downsteam impacts

and opportunities for public health agencies,

including the availability of specific data elements

that enable and are required for reporting

purposes.

Value Set maintenance and provisioning Agreed upon vocabulary value sets associated with

public health reporting data elements must be

maintained. These value sets are critical for EHR /

clinical setting data sources, intermediaries (e.g

health information exchanges), and public health

agency receivers for data validation and

translation. Nationwide and local governance and

technical infrastructure are necessary to enable

implementation, adoption, and sustainability.

Health Information Standards Bodies and

Processes

Public health reporting will rely on standardized

information exchange format and content

standards. These base standards rely on balloting

and consensus processes to promote industry

acceptance and adoption. Current and future

public health reporting specifications may be

dependent on these bodies and their associated

consensus building, maintenance, and distribution

processes.

Healthcare Provider and Public Health Agency

Processes, Procedures, and Tools

In order to realize the full potential of the PHRI

specification, it is recognized that short and long

term commitments from vendors is needed. This

involves providing software tools and/or other

7.2 Additional Components and Considerations Public health reporting relies on a number of operations that are outside the scope of the functional

requirements and information exchange descriptions captured in this document. Capturing additional

components of the overall public health business process and system flows will be important both in the

specific design and exchange serving a specific public health program / jurisdiction. This includes the

sustainability / extensibilty of public health reporting requirements as the public health programs,

policies, systems and infrastructure change over time. These important components and considerations

include, but are not limited to:

Type Description

Reporting criteria Provider-initiated public health reports rely on

specific criteria associated with jurisdictional /

program policies, public health case definitions,

data availability, provider expertise, and other

factors. These report criteria may change over

time or between jurisdictions, and the technical

systems will require a means to understand which

criteria apply and when criteria change (e.g. when

a new reportable event is added, which

sometimes occurs emergently during an outbreak).

Both public health agencies and healthcare

providers need to consider how information about

criteria are made available, updated and how

notification of change is accomplished. When

automated report triggering is used, how might

systems operating such algorithms receive and

implement different criteria across jurisdictions or

over time? A public health reportable condition

knowledge base may help facilitate up-to-date

access.

Reportable event filters and templates As information exchange specifications for each

public health report are developed and

maintained, reporting templates and filters may be

made available to system senders and receivers, to

facilitate and accelerate reporting. A public health

reportable event knowledge base may help

Security / Trust Reporting to a public health agency will require a

level of trust between the agency and the

reporting party. As security, accessibility, and

privacy policies and infrastructure are developed,

it will be important that public health reporting

specifications account for these needs. An

important component of this trust is accounting

for program jurisdiction in both the data content

and associated data use accessibility requirements,

including requirements for authentication,

authorization, non-repudiation, and attestation of

the report (via electronic signature or other

mechanism).

Validation / data management processes There are multiple types of validation processes

involved in a public health reporting process,

including message / report format conformance,

data / content verification, error handling, and

case de-duplication and record merging. The

requirements for these processes vary between

the policies, capacities, and needs of particular

programs and jurisdictions. Implementations of

specific public health reporting exchanges in

specific jurisdictions should follow the guidance,

recommendations, and best practices advocated

by various stakeholders, which may include

professional associations, patient advocacy

groups, and/or sponsoring federal, state, and local

agency programs. Table 8: Additional Considerations

8.0 Dataset Requirements The PHRI will identify the data elements along with associated value sets and related guidelines that

have been provided by each domain and/or across domains. 3 This task will result in a PHRI Data

Harmonization Profile that will help promote normalized field definitions, vocabulary bindings, and

content requirements to facilitate the analysis of base content exchange (e.g. HL7 2.x, HL7 Clinical

Document Architecture and terminology standards and future standards development harmonization

tasks). This document is available on the Public Health Reporting Initiative wiki, here:

http://wiki.siframework.org/PHRI+-+Data+%26Terminology+Harmonization+Sub-Workgroup.

As described in the Data Harmonization Profile, the data elements for public health reporting can be

broken down into 3 classifications:

• Core Common Data Elements – harmonized data elements that are widely shared across several

report types. Expect EHR systems to be able to produce these data elements but public health

systems may choose to receive these elements at their discretion. Identifying and harmonizing

core common data elements are the primary focus of the Data Harmonization Profile.

• Report Type Specific Data Elements – harmonized data elements (although variance is allowed

where necessary) that are broadly required across public health for a specific report type (e.g., a

communicable disease case report, a birth record report, etc.). Special effort is taken to

harmonize elements between different report types, but this is a secondary effort of the PHRI at

this time. Where possible, report type data elements are detailed and harmonized, but future

companion documents and phases of the Public Health Reporting Initiative may be required to

cover data elements for various types of reports.

• Implementation Specific Data Elements – additional, relatively unique, or non-harmonized data

elements required by a particular jurisdiction or public health program (e.g., a TB report in

California). Defining these elements is out of scope for the Data Harmonization Profile and the

Public Health Reporting Initiative at this time.

Specific public health reporting scenarios, either ‘report type-specific’ or ‘implementation-specific’, will

provide their own requirements for optionality but can take advantage of harmonized value sets and

terminology.

9.0 Standards Analysis In the standards analysis phase, the PHRI will analyze the data harmonization profile, as well as review

relevant existing implementation guides, against the requirements described in the functional

requirements documents. This will help the initiative determine the best data exchange specification

and selection of appropriate data elements, terminologies and value sets. It is possible that different

public health reporting user stories and report types will require different specifications as a result of

this analysis. Our approach will identify a uniform set of “common core data elements” valid for many

different types of public health reports, and “extension data elements” that include unique needs for a

particular type of public health report. This information can be used by EHR and other software

vendors and public health agency system support teams to determine gaps and opportunities for

enhancing existing products, tools, services and infrastructure to support testing and adoption of the

PHRI specifications.
